An Ode To NYC: Mougabé Saint Louis
We are a Gotham-based brand, and as such, we love to champion our own. Today, we’d like to introduce you to a young, upcoming artist/photographer by the name of Mougabé Saint Louis. Interesting tidbit here; for a while, he actually used to be part of the Onassis Soho crew. But these days, he is spreading his wings and unveiling his full potential. To date, he has been involved in projects with Agenda & Milk Studios, and he’s presently shooting a collaborative t-shirt series with a progressive brand called DIEM. Throughout his work, the one common denominator is the authentic NYC attitude and energy that influences his creativity. Below, we delve a little deeper into the relationship between an artist and the city he represents.
Your most memorable childhood moment in NYC?
I can never pinpoint a specific event because growing up in NYC, everyday is an adventure that was better than the last. Right now, I’m more concerned with the memories of today and dreams of tomorrow.
Favorite NYC stomping grounds?
Brooklyn by far, not only is it home, but a hub for convenience & creatives. I’ve grown up to see Brooklyn transform into a completely new world. It’s the new Manhattan.
Spot in NYC where you draw the most inspiration?
Flatbush, LES/Washington Heights – they hold the perfect balance of New York’s past and present.
Favorite NYC Artist of All time?
Jamel Shabazz, he influences my love for photography the most.
Favorite NYC Musician of All Time?
Biggie Smalls.
Being that you’re a photographer, what’s your favorite place in NYC to shoot?
I don’t have a specific area in NYC I like to shoot – that puts too much restrictions on my creative drive. I need to explore this city/the states/the world.
Most fashionable area in NYC for seeing authentic style?
Everywhere in NYC has authentic style. The diversity in our dress code down to our body language and slang, our reputation is world renowned.
Favorite place to party and have a good time?
For me, it’s not where I party, but who I party with.
Favorite spot to kick back and chill with friends?
Nowhere in particular, New York is our playground, we have fun wherever we go.
What is it to you about NYC that makes it so unique from every other city in the world?
There is no formality of character in New York, everyone’s an individual, everything is so colorful, living here is a true experience.
Where do you envision your artistic/creative evolution going in the next 5 years?
Passing down knowledge, investing in life & love, traveling the world, not giving a fuck about conforming, evolving as a man before an artist, publishing books, creating new art through my children.
